What Exactly is a Casino Deposit Bonus?

At its core, a casino deposit bonus is a promotional offer from an online casino that rewards you for depositing money into your player account. It’s essentially the casino saying, “Thank you for choosing us! Here’s a little extra to get you started or keep you playing.” These bonuses come in various forms, but the most common type involves the casino matching a percentage of your deposit up to a certain amount.

Think of it as free playing credit, though it comes with specific rules and conditions attached – we’ll get into those shortly. Understanding these different types is your first step to becoming a savvy bonus hunter.

Matched Deposit Bonuses

This is the most prevalent form of a casino deposit bonus. The casino matches a percentage of your deposit, typically 100%, but it can range anywhere from 50% to 500% or more. There’s always a maximum bonus amount specified.

  • Example: A “100% Match Bonus up to $200” means if you deposit $100, the casino gives you an extra $100, leaving you with $200 to play with. If you deposit $250, you’ll still only get the maximum $200 bonus, resulting in $450 total.

These bonuses are fantastic for new players looking to maximize their initial playtime and for existing players taking advantage of reload offers.

Free Spins Bonuses

Often offered alongside a matched deposit bonus, or sometimes as a standalone deposit offer, free spins give you a set number of spins on specific slot games without using your own cash. Winnings from these free spins are usually converted into bonus funds, subject to wagering requirements.

  • Example: “Deposit $20 and get 50 Free Spins on Starburst.” After making your qualifying deposit, 50 spins will be credited to your account on the Starburst slot. Any money you win from those spins then becomes bonus money that needs to be wagered.

Free spins are a great way to try out popular slots or new game releases without risking your own money directly.

Reload Bonuses

These are deposit bonuses offered to existing players, rather than just new sign-ups. Reload bonuses are designed to encourage players to make subsequent deposits after their initial welcome offer has been used. They often follow the same percentage-match structure as welcome bonuses but might be smaller in percentage or maximum amount.

  • Example: “Get a 50% Reload Bonus up to $100 every Tuesday!” If you deposit $50, you’d get an extra $25.

Loyalty programs and regular promotions often feature reload bonuses, providing ongoing value for consistent players.

High-Roller Bonuses

As the name suggests, these bonuses are tailored for players who deposit and wager larger sums of money. They typically offer higher maximum bonus amounts and sometimes more favorable terms, though they require a significantly larger minimum deposit to qualify.

  • Example: “Deposit $1,000 or more and get a 100% bonus up to $2,000.” This is a clear indicator that the bonus is targeting players comfortable with larger bankrolls.

High rollers often receive personalized offers and VIP treatment, making these bonuses quite exclusive.

How Do Casino Deposit Bonuses Work? The Mechanics Explained

Understanding the “anatomy” of a casino deposit bonus is crucial. It’s not just about the big number in the advertisement; it’s about the terms and conditions that dictate how you can use the bonus and eventually withdraw any winnings. Let’s dissect the key components.

Understanding the Match Percentage and Max Bonus

This is the most visible part of any deposit bonus offer. The match percentage tells you how much of your deposit the casino will add as bonus funds, and the max bonus amount is the ceiling for that bonus.

  • Match Percentage: This is expressed as a percentage, e.g., 100%, 200%. If it’s 100%, your bonus equals your deposit. If 200%, your bonus is double your deposit.
  • Max Bonus Amount: This is the maximum amount of bonus money you can receive, regardless of how large your deposit is.

Scenario: An offer states “200% up to $500.”

  1. If you deposit $100, you get $200 bonus (200% of $100). Total playing funds: $300.
  2. If you deposit $250, you get $500 bonus (200% of $250). Total playing funds: $750.
  3. If you deposit $300, you still only get the maximum $500 bonus, not $600. Total playing funds: $800.

Always calculate how much bonus you’ll actually receive for your intended deposit amount.

Wagering Requirements Explained (The Most Important Part!)

This is where many players get tripped up. A wagering requirement (also known as a “playthrough” requirement) is the total amount of money you must bet using your bonus funds (and sometimes your deposit) before any associated winnings can be withdrawn. It’s expressed as a multiplier, e.g., 20x, 35x, 50x.

Here’s how it works with a mathematical example:

Let’s say you claim a “100% Match Bonus up to $100” with a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ount only.

  1. You deposit $100 and receive a $100 bonus. Your total playing funds are $200.
  2. The wagering requirement applies to the bonus: $100 (bonus) x 30 (wagering requirement) = $3,000.
  3. This means you need to place bets totaling $3,000 before you can withdraw any winnings derived from that bonus money.

What if the wagering requirement applies to both the deposit AND bonus (D+B)?

  1. You deposit $100 and receive a $100 bonus. Total playing funds: $200.
  2. The wagering requirement applies to (Deposit + Bonus): ($100 + $100) x 30 = $200 x 30 = $6,000.

Clearly, a D+B wagering requirement is significantly harder to meet. Always look for bonuses where wagering applies only to the bonus amount. A good wagering requirement is generally considered anything below 35x for the bonus amount or 20x for (D+B).

Minimum Deposit and Max Bet

  • Minimum Deposit: Every bonus will have a minimum amount you need to deposit to qualify for the offer. This is usually around $10-$20 but can vary.
  • Max Bet: When playing with bonus funds, casinos almost always impose a maximum bet limit per spin or round. Exceeding this limit can result in your bonus and any winnings being forfeited. This is a common pitfall for new players!

Always check these limits. The maximum bet is often around $5-$10 per spin.

Game Contribution Percentages

Not all games contribute equally to fulfilling wagering requirements. This is a critical detail. Most slots contribute 100%, meaning every $1 you bet counts as $1 towards your wagering target.

However, games with lower house edges, like blackjack, roulette, or video poker, often contribute much less, sometimes 10-20%, or even 0%. If you’re playing a game that contributes 10% and you bet $10, only $1 will count towards clearing your bonus.

Always consult the bonus T&Cs for the game contribution table. Playing games with low or no contribution is a surefire way to struggle with wagering.

Time Limits

Bonuses don’t last forever! You’ll have a specific timeframe, usually 7 to 30 days, to claim the bonus, use the bonus funds, and meet the wagering requirements. If you don’t complete the wagering within this period, the bonus funds and any winnings derived from them will expire.

Bonus Codes

Some casino deposit bonus offers require you to enter a specific “bonus code” during the deposit process to activate the promotion. If you forget to enter the code, you might miss out on the bonus. Always double-check if a code is needed.

Payment Method Exclusions

Occasionally, certain deposit methods (e.g., Skrill, Neteller, or specific cryptocurrencies) might be excluded from qualifying for a casino deposit bonus. Always check if your preferred payment method is eligible before making your deposit.

Comparing Bonus Offers

Don’t just look at the percentage and maximum amount. Dig deeper to compare the true value:

  1. Wagering Requirements: Lower is always better. 20x (bonus) is much better than 40x (D+B).
  2. Game Contributions: If you love slots, 100% contribution is standard. If you prefer table games, look for bonuses that include them with reasonable contributions.
  3. Max Bet: A higher max bet allows for more flexible gameplay while clearing the bonus.
  4. Time Limits: More time means less pressure to rush your play.
  5. Overall Value: A 100% bonus with 20x wagering is often better than a 200% bonus with 50x (D+B) wagering.

It’s about the probability of actually converting the bonus into withdrawable cash, not just the initial boost.

Tips, Strategies, and Best Practices for Using Casino Deposit Bonuses

Maximizing your bonus isn’t just about finding the right offer; it’s also about how you use it. Here are some smart strategies to improve your chances of success.

  1. Choose Bonuses Wisely: As discussed, don’t be swayed by the biggest numbers. Focus on achievable wagering requirements and reasonable terms.
  2. Start with Lower Volatility Games (Initially): When clearing wagering requirements, especially with a strict time limit, consider playing slots with lower volatility. These games pay out more frequently (though often smaller amounts), helping you maintain your balance and chip away at the wagering requirement. Once you’re closer to clearing, you can consider higher volatility games for bigger win potential.
  3. Track Your Progress: Most casinos will have a bonus tracker in your account section. Regularly check it to see how much more you need to wager. This helps you manage your time and strategy.
  4. Understand Game Contributions: Seriously, this is a big one. If you’re going to play a game that only contributes 10%, factor that into your wagering calculations. It might be more efficient to play a 100% contribution slot, even if it’s not your absolute favorite game, until the wagering is complete.
  5. Bankroll Management: Even with bonus funds, sound bankroll management is essential. Treat bonus money as part of your overall gaming budget. Don’t chase losses, and establish limits on how much you’re willing to wager and potentially lose. A bonus is a boost, not a guaranteed win.
  6. Responsible Gambling: Always remember that gambling should be for entertainment. Set time and money limits for yourself. Never gamble more than you can afford to lose. If you feel you’re losing control, seek help from organizations like BeGambleAware or Gamblers Anonymous. Bonuses are fun, but your well-being comes first.

Common Mistakes to Avoid with Online Casino Deposit Bonuses

Even experienced players can fall victim to common pitfalls. Being aware of these mistakes will help you steer clear of disappointment.

  1. Not Reading the Terms and Conditions (T&Cs): This is the cardinal sin. Every bonus comes with rules. Ignoring them is the fastest way to lose your bonus and winnings.
  2. Ignoring Wagering Requirements: Claiming a huge bonus without understanding how much you need to bet before withdrawing is a recipe for frustration. Always calculate it beforehand.
  3. Exceeding Max Bet Limits: This is a very common mistake. Playing with bonus funds means adhering to a maximum bet per spin/round. Go over it, and your bonus funds and any associated winnings can be immediately forfeited.
  4. Playing Excluded or Low-Contribution Games: Some games are entirely excluded from bonus play, while others contribute very little. Playing these games will either get your bonus voided or make clearing the wagering requirements incredibly difficult.
  5. Chasing Losses: If you’re on a losing streak, don’t increase your bets or deposit more just to “get back” what you lost, especially when trying to clear a bonus. This goes against good bankroll management and responsible gambling.
  6. Claiming Too Many Bonuses at Once: While enticing, managing multiple bonuses from different casinos simultaneously can be confusing and lead to mistakes (like missing time limits or violating max bet rules). Focus on one at a time.
  7. Using Ineligible Payment Methods: Double-check if your chosen deposit method qualifies for the bonus. Some e-wallets are occasionally excluded.
  8. Not Using a Bonus Code (If Required): If a bonus code is specified, failing to enter it during your deposit means you won’t receive the bonus.

Understanding Expected Value (EV) of a Bonus

For the more mathematically inclined, the Expected Value (EV) of a bonus is a concept that helps determine if a bonus is “profitable” on average. It calculates the average outcome if you were to play out the bonus an infinite number of times.

Simplified EV Calculation:

EV = (Bonus Amount * (1 – House Edge) ^ (Wagering Requirement / Average Bet Size)) – (Wagering Requirement * House Edge)

This is complex, but a simpler way to think about it is:

EV = Bonus Amount - (Wagering Requirement * Game House Edge)

Let’s say a bonus is $100 with a 30x wagering requirement ($3000 total wagering) on a slot with a 3% house edge (RTP 97%).

  • Expected loss from wagering: $3000 * 0.03 = $90
  • Expected Value of Bonus: $100 (bonus) – $90 (expected loss) = +$10

A positive EV suggests the bonus is mathematically favorable in the long run. A negative EV means, on average, you’re expected to lose money, even with the bonus. While individual results vary, aiming for positive EV bonuses is an advanced strategy.

Advanced Bankroll Allocation

When playing with a bonus, consider how you allocate your total bankroll (your deposited cash + bonus funds). Some strategies suggest using your “real money” balance first on lower variance games to build up some winnings, then switching to higher variance games with the bonus funds to try for a big win, or vice-versa. This depends heavily on the bonus structure (e.g., sticky vs. non-sticky bonus) and your personal risk tolerance.

Always understand if the bonus is “sticky” (cannot be withdrawn, only used for play) or “non-sticky” (bonus funds can be withdrawn after wagering). Most modern bonuses are non-sticky.

F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ions About Casino Deposit Bonuses

Q1: Can I withdraw my bonus money immediately?

A1: No, almost never. You must first meet the bonus’s wagering requirements. Once you’ve wagered the required amount, any remaining bonus funds and associated winnings convert into real cash, which you can then withdraw.

Q2: What is considered a good wagering requirement?

A2: Generally, a wagering requirement of 35x or less on the bonus amount (e.g., 35x bonus) is considered fair. If the requirement applies to both the deposit and bonus (D+B), then 20x or less (e.g., 20x D+B) is good. Anything significantly higher makes it very difficult to convert the bonus into withdrawable cash.

Q3: Do all games contribute equally to wagering requirements?

A3: No, they don’t. Most slot games contribute 100%, but table games like blackjack, roulette, and video poker usually contribute much less (e.g., 10-20%) or are sometimes excluded entirely due to their lower house edge. Always check the bonus terms for game contribution percentages.

Q4: What happens if I don’t meet the wagering requirements in time?

A4: If you don’t fulfill the wagering requirements within the specified time limit, the bonus funds and any winnings derived from them will typically expire and be removed from your account.

Q5: Are casino deposit bonuses truly “free money”?

A5: Not in the sense of being handed cash without any strings attached. While they give you extra funds to play with, the wagering requirements mean you have to bet a significant amount before you can withdraw anything. They are “free play” money with conditions.

Q6: Can I claim multiple deposit bonuses at the same casino?

A6: Usually, you can only have one active bonus at a time. After completing or forfeiting one bonus (like a welcome bonus), you can typically claim subsequent offers like reload bonuses. However, you cannot claim the same welcome bonus multiple times or use multiple active bonuses simultaneously.

Q7: Are there any deposit bonuses without wagering requirements?

A7: These are rare but do exist, often referred to as “wager-free bonuses.” They are highly sought after because any winnings from the bonus or free spins are immediately withdrawable. Such offers are usually smaller in value or have stricter conditions elsewhere (e.g., max cashout limits). When you see one, definitely investigate it!

Q8: What’s the difference between a deposit bonus and a no-deposit bonus?

A8: A deposit bonus requires you to make a qualifying deposit to receive the bonus funds or free spins. A no-deposit bonus, as the name suggests, does not require a deposit; you simply sign up or register to receive a small bonus (usually free spins or a small amount of bonus cash). No-deposit bonuses generally have higher wagering requirements and lower maximum cashout limits.
